Cozumel to carry out drill in preparation of 2023 hurricane season

Cozumel, Q.R. — Cozumel Civil Protection along with members of the Municipal Civil Protection Council and the Specialized Operating Committee on Hydrometeorological Phenomena (COEFH) to reaffirm actions prior to the start of hurricane season.

The island agencies said their meeting focused on being able to provide a prompt response in case of contingency for the benefit of the citizens of Cozumel.

“Because Cozumel’s geographical location is prone to the ravages of a tropical cyclone, the Municipal Government, chaired by Juanita Alonso Marrufo, held a meeting to reaffirm the functions that the 13 subcommittees must carry out to face emergency risk situations in an organized manner that arise during the 2023 season,” they reported in a statement.

At the meeting it was announced that on May 22, an exercise will be carried out in which the hypothesis of the threat of a tropical cyclone to the Cozumel coasts will be established.
